We are sharing a specialised remote opportunity for an experienced Compliance Manager III to support privacy training and regulatory compliance initiatives at a leading technology company. This role focuses on maintaining and improving privacy training safeguards, compliance monitoring, and audit readiness across complex organisational environments. The position is ideal for professionals experienced in compliance operations, regulatory programs, or privacy governance who are comfortable managing multiple initiatives in fast-paced and evolving regulatory environments. The selected professional will work cross-functionally with privacy, legal, policy, engineering, product, and learning teams to ensure privacy training programs remain compliant with regulatory requirements and internal governance standards.
